Passing on their Jewish traditions

As populations vary, area Jews try new ways to keep community

Today begins the Days of Remembrance, a national memorial week for the Holocaust lasting through April 22. The commemoration honors the Jewish community, an ethnic group that has carried unique values, knowledge, and religion across centuries - and through a genocide that killed more than 6 million. As the country honors the post-mass murder survival of an entire culture, a mosaic of new projects in the suburbs south of Boston aim to strengthen local Jewish community.
